Understanding the Meaning of Gold Star Families
Gold Star Families are those who have endured one of the greatest sacrifices imaginable losing a loved one in military service to the nation. The term “Gold Star” traces back to World War I when families displayed service flags in their homes. Each blue star represented a family member in active service, and when that loved one died in the line of duty, the blue star was replaced with gold to honor their ultimate sacrifice. How the Title of Gold Star Families Is Honored
In the United States, the government and various organizations recognize the importance of honoring Gold Star Families for their sacrifice. Gold Star Mother’s and Family’s Day is observed annually on the last Sunday of September to pay tribute to these families. Many memorials, monuments, and foundations also exist across the country to recognize their strength and courage. Events are held where communities come together to support and celebrate these families, ensuring that their loved one’s sacrifice is never forgotten. The symbolic Gold Star lapel pins are also given to next of kin to signify honor, remembrance, and national gratitude. The Historical Roots of Gold Star Families
The tradition of honoring Gold Star Families began during World War I, when American households proudly displayed service flags. Each blue star represented a loved one actively serving in the military. When a service member was killed in action, the family changed the blue star to a gold one to symbolize the honor and sacrifice associated with their loss. Over the years, this tradition evolved into a powerful symbol of respect for families who have given their loved ones in service.
